Mammography Technologist
- Diagnostic Radiology. This is a screening only Mammography Tech position.
Are you a skilled Mammography Technologist who takes pride in delivering exceptional patient care? At Pacific Medical Centers, you'll perform a variety of radiological procedures focused on the diagnosis and treatment of breast disease in a dynamic, high-volume outpatient setting - where your expertise directly impacts patient outcomes. You'll produce high-quality mammographic images while creating a calm, comforting experience for every patient who walks through our doors, and play an active role in upholding quality standards as required by the Mammography Quality Standards Act (MQSA) and the FDA.
At select locations, your general radiography skills may also be called upon to support diagnostic exams.

Required qualifications:
- Successful completion of a formal radiologic technology training program, which meets the requirements for registry by the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T).
- Upon hire:
Washington Radiologic Technologist. - Upon hire:
National Provider BLS
- American Heart Association. - Upon hire:
National Registered Technologist
- Radiography
- American Registry of Radiologic Technologists - Within 1 year of hire:
National Registered Technologist
- Mammography. - Dependant on location, prior general radiography experience may be required.
Preferred qualifications:
- 2 years Full-time mammography experience.
